In operator theory, particularly the study of PDEs, operators are particularly easy to understand and PDEs easy to solve if the operator is diagonal with respect to the basis with which one is working this corresponds to a separable partial differential equation. Furthermore, the singular value decomposition implies that for any matrix A, there exist unitary matrices U and V such that U ∗AV is diagonal with positive entries. The spectral theorem says that every normal matrix is unitarily similar to a diagonal matrix (if AA ∗ = A ∗ A then there exists a unitary matrix U such that UAU ∗ is diagonal). Over the field of real or complex numbers, more is true. Such matrices are said to be diagonalizable. In fact, a given n-by- n matrix A is similar to a diagonal matrix (meaning that there is a matrix X such that X −1 AX is diagonal) if and only if it has n linearly independent eigenvectors. Because of the simple description of the matrix operation and eigenvalues/eigenvectors given above, it is typically desirable to represent a given matrix or linear map by a diagonal matrix.
